What is a Chimney Cooker Hood?
A [chimney cooker hood](https://www.ernawilhelmy.top/technology/understanding-chimney-cooker-hoods-a-comprehensive-guide/), typically called a chimney hood, is a kitchen appliance set up above the cooking range to extract smoke, grease, steam, and smells while cooking. Its style features a vertical structure resembling a chimney, giving it its name. These hoods can be ducted (venting air exterior) or recirculating (filtering and reestablishing air), catering to varying kitchen setups.

Improved Air Quality: Chimney hoods effectively eliminate damaging vapors, guaranteeing a healthier cooking environment.

Smell Elimination: They help remove cooking smells, avoiding them from settling in furnishings or upholstery.

Grease Reduction: A chimney hood limitations grease accumulation on surface areas, making kitchen cleaning easier.

Improves Kitchen Aesthetics: Available in numerous styles, they can act as a focal point in kitchen style.

Increased Kitchen Comfort: By enhancing air flow, they make cooking more enjoyable, especially in restricted kitchen spaces.

Setting up a chimney cooker hood can be a straightforward process, however appropriate guidelines should be followed. Here is a list of vital installation suggestions:

Select the Right Height: The ideal height for installation is generally in between 26-30 inches above the cooking surface.

Consider the Ductwork: Ensure sufficient ducting is in place if you go with a ducted model. Short, straight duct runs lessen loss of suction.

Confirm Electrical Needs: Check the hood's requirements for electrical requirements and guarantee correct electrical wiring.

Follow Manufacturer Instructions: Each brand might have distinct procedures; always refer to the maker's guide.

Secure Proper Ventilation: Ensure proper ventilation outside the home for ducted hoods, preventing backdrafts.
FAQs About Chimney Cooker Hoods
1. How do I know which size chimney hood to purchase?To identify the proper size, think about the width of your cooking range. The hood needs to match or be slightly larger than the cooking appliance, generally 3-6 inches wider.

2. Do chimney hoods work without ducting?Yes, recirculating (non-ducted) designs can filter and purify the air before launching it back into the kitchen. Nevertheless, they might be less reliable than ducted variations.

3. How frequently should I clean up the filters?It's advisable to clean grease filters monthly and change charcoal filters roughly every 6 months, depending upon usage.

4. Can chimney hoods be used over all kinds of cookers?The majority of designs appropriate for gas and electrical cookers. However, inspect the maker's standards to ensure compatibility.

5. What is the average cost of chimney cooker hoods?Prices differ substantially, ranging anywhere from ₤ 100 for fundamental designs to over ₤ 2,000 for high-end, designer versions.
Upkeep of Chimney Cooker Hoods
To guarantee durability and effective performance of chimney cooker hoods, regular upkeep is important. It can prevent breakdowns and maintain optimal duct performance.
Maintenance ChecklistTidy the Filters: Remove and clean grease filters frequently.Check the Fan: Inspect and clean up the fan and motor to guarantee they operate correctly.Check Ductwork: Periodically inspect ducts for clogs or buildup.Polish the Surface: Use appropriate cleaning items to prevent scratches and preserve shine on the exterior.Test the Lighting: Regularly check light functions and change burnt-out bulbs immediately.
